Output 7b7951c7e2c260a657d675a24c1cf108ea140b3b7bc7fc1c901a7ef9d863ff1a:71

value
19413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ac1eb63223615df7e381c864fecf45917d709d37 OP_EQUAL
address
3HP6wRcFYN8t2P27pDminQr32VecPReKjy
transaction
7b7951c7e2c260a657d675a24c1cf108ea140b3b7bc7fc1c901a7ef9d863ff1a
spent
true